Florian Philippot, who heads the opposition Patriots party in France, called the EU, where politicians want to impose sanctions against Nord Streams, a madhouse where madness prevails. TASS informs about this today, May 22.
The politician also called such a decision "a death sentence for the industry of European countries."
"Fantastic madness! Ursula von der Leyen is already preparing the "18th package of sanctions against Russia," which will include "the final destruction of the Nord Streams pipelines,— Filippo wrote on social networks.
He does not intend to stand on ceremony with Ursula von der Leyen at all.
"We urgently need to put Ursula out the door and get out of the EU, this is a madhouse," the politician summed up.
